Tsugami Corporation (TYO:6101)
Japan flag Japan · Delayed Price · Currency is JPY
1,760.00
+6.00 (0.34%)
Apr 30, 2025, 3:30 PM JST

Tsugami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Apr '25 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2015 - 2019
Market Capitalization
83,13654,67969,08364,37584,63839,122
Upgrade
Market Cap Growth
27.33%-20.85%7.32%-23.94%116.35%-12.04%
Upgrade
Enterprise Value
86,53155,10976,31565,99785,15844,851
Upgrade
Last Close Price
1754.001111.071330.631190.651449.93645.69
Upgrade
PE Ratio
8.8310.178.986.7917.2119.55
Upgrade
Forward PE
-7.348.026.5115.4012.93
Upgrade
PS Ratio
0.870.650.730.691.370.79
Upgrade
PB Ratio
0.990.761.061.111.811.00
Upgrade
P/TBV Ratio
1.330.971.371.442.281.25
Upgrade
P/FCF Ratio
18.835.789.6519.1518.926.98
Upgrade
P/OCF Ratio
13.414.608.3210.2312.484.89
Upgrade
PEG Ratio
-0.500.500.500.500.50
Upgrade
EV/Sales Ratio
0.900.660.800.711.380.91
Upgrade
EV/EBITDA Ratio
4.343.944.283.038.087.97
Upgrade
EV/EBIT Ratio
4.844.624.833.319.4310.23
Upgrade
EV/FCF Ratio
19.605.8210.6619.6419.048.01
Upgrade
Debt / Equity Ratio
0.160.240.280.240.210.24
Upgrade
Debt / EBITDA Ratio
0.661.231.010.620.941.63
Upgrade
Debt / FCF Ratio
2.961.822.524.042.221.64
Upgrade
Asset Turnover
0.800.730.881.020.870.75
Upgrade
Inventory Turnover
1.801.691.922.442.271.78
Upgrade
Quick Ratio
1.621.491.181.141.281.16
Upgrade
Current Ratio
2.702.322.071.911.992.06
Upgrade
Return on Equity (ROE)
17.76%11.92%17.67%24.11%15.45%6.94%
Upgrade
Return on Assets (ROA)
9.35%6.48%9.14%13.62%8.00%4.17%
Upgrade
Return on Capital (ROIC)
12.27%8.64%12.79%19.45%10.75%5.51%
Upgrade
Return on Capital Employed (ROCE)
20.00%15.40%23.00%32.80%18.40%10.70%
Upgrade
Earnings Yield
11.44%9.83%11.14%14.74%5.81%5.12%
Upgrade
FCF Yield
5.31%17.31%10.36%5.22%5.29%14.32%
Upgrade
Dividend Yield
3.08%4.32%3.46%3.36%1.79%3.72%
Upgrade
Payout Ratio
25.54%42.97%27.68%16.86%25.26%62.17%
Upgrade
Buyback Yield / Dilution
1.44%1.01%3.03%4.53%0.35%1.35%
Upgrade
Total Shareholder Return
4.52%5.33%6.49%7.89%2.14%5.07%
Upgrade
Updated Jan 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.